Output 68ca82f5188375dc3b26e4ae0dd7200e98bbd6320ffba202f60e1f65e1de08b4:5

value
44673773
script pubkey
OP_HASH160 OP_PUSHBYTES_20 b9bb5749af3c1edc9928f7ac03b234c7e75b987e OP_EQUAL
address
MQqDfbcAPobuWo9cT5XMrbc2n4JtNRfXN9
transaction
68ca82f5188375dc3b26e4ae0dd7200e98bbd6320ffba202f60e1f65e1de08b4
spent
true